About Eugeniusz Koda

Eugeniusz Koda is a scholar working on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ering, Civil and Structural Engineering and Pollution, having authored 170 papers that have together received 2.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Landfill Environmental Impact Studies (38 papers), Geotechnical Engineering and Soil Stabilization (24 papers) and Waste Management and Environmental Impact (17 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(585 cit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(610 citations) and Pollution (319 citations). Eugeniusz Koda has collaborated with scholars based in Poland, Czechia and Ukraine. Frequent co-authors include Magdalena Daria Vaverková, Piotr Osiński, Anna Sieczka, Anna Podlasek, Jan Winkler, D. S. Vijayan, Dana Adamcová, Arvindan Sivasuriyan, Aleksandra Jakimiuk and Parthiban Devarajan.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Renewable and Sustainable Energy Reviews and PLoS ONE.
